Hamilton firefighters have managed to contain a small blaze which set a tractor and its silage stack on fire.
Northern Fire Communications shift manager Daniel Nicholson said it was difficult to get the fire under control at first because of a shortage of water and foam.
The silage stack measured 20m by 40m, he said.
Four appliances, including a water tanker, were sent to the Te Pahu Rd, Ngahinapouri property at 8.30am.
"We just need water and foam, not because it's a big fire, more because there's a lack of water."
